Stable, but limited bandwidth 
2008-04-30
Was happy with the stability of this unit for over a year, but always wondered why there have been no firmware updates since the units release several years ago...I recently upgraded my internet service from 6 to 10Mbps and was surprised to see no difference in my downstream speed. Tech support had me disconnect my Belkin N1 and attach my PC directly to the cable modem. Speed jumped up to 9.6Mbps. Replaced the Belkin with an Apple Airport Extreme, which has no problem delivering full download bandwidth.

Good ..With some Tweak 
2008-06-07
Bought this router since I am moving to a new place. Previous routers are Linksys or 3com. So time to try Belkin. Initial impression, looks are impressing.
Setting up is easy.
There are some problems that I encountered i.e. losing connection, etc, but after research the internet, things can be solved by upgrading the firmware to the latest one.
Now, I am happy with the Belkin N1.
So if you have problem with your Belkin, try this:
1. Upgrade your firmware (Sometimes, you need to get the beta version from Belkin UK - since its not in the USA Belkin website)
2. Make sure your Qos turned off
3. Turn on the Signal to (20+40 hz).
Then it will solve all the Belkin problems.
vpn, voip (SIP device), all works fine after that.
Do I recommend this product? Yup
If you are a beginner and wants to buy this router, ask your friend to help you to upgrade the firmware and setting up.
